On this Thursday episode of Nothing Major, Sam, John, and Stevie sit down with director Jason Hehir (The Last Dance) to break down his new Amazon feature doc Novak Djokovic: The Wolf in Winter. Hehir explains how the project began in 2017, how he came aboard in 2023, the challenges of filming a story unfolding in real time, and why the original concept “The Two Novaks” evolved into The Wolf in Winter. They also discuss the trust-building process with Novak, the similarities and differences between Djokovic and Michael Jordan, and what surprised Hehir most about Novak as a father and competitor.
Plus, the guys launch a new Sam segment: a snake draft of current top-100 players they least want on their team in a pool-table bar fight. Finally, they preview Roger Federer’s upcoming Hall of Fame induction, sharing behind-the-scenes stories about how approachable and normal Roger is off court.

10/08/2026 | 48 mins.Canada has turned into a full-on bloodbath. Djokovic, Sinner and Alcaraz were already missing, and then plenty of the “safe” top seeds followed them out the door. Zverev calls his loss to Griekspoor his “worst match of the season,” Fritz looks cooked after his Monday final in DC, and Félix doesn’t even make it on court in his hometown because of a back issue.
The result? A wide-open Masters with a historic last eight: for the first time, every Masters 1000 quarterfinalist was born in 2000 or later, with 25-year-old Brandon Nakashima somehow the elder statesman. We break down Shelton vs. Mensik, Jodar’s rapid rise, why Canada creates so much chaos, and which young player has the biggest opportunity this week.
On the women’s side, Toronto finally delivers the heavyweight matchups. We look at the draw while debating Sabalenka’s recent losses, whether Iga is starting to turn things around, and a wide-open race to finish the year at No. 1.
Then it’s on to Cincinnati. How concerning is Sinner’s withdrawal ahead of the US Open? John thinks it matters; Stevie is waiting to see what the New York practice-court cameras tell us. Plus, Sam somehow turns his “query” into an Ealamania discussion... and, for once, we all agree!

Join former American tennis stars Sam Querrey, John Isner & Steve Johnson as they hope to serve up more laughs than Grand Slam titles on the podcast Nothing Major.
Expect untold tales, a behind the scenes look at life on tour, and relentless banter that only comes from guys who've seen it all (except that elusive major win).
